Contactar
+34651436612 (Home)
Miguel Alvarez Villegas
miguel568@yahoo.es Cloud DevOps and SRE Engineer at Accelya
Madrid y alrededores
www.linkedin.com/in/
miguelalvarezvillegas (LinkedIn)
Extracto
Aptitudes principales 20 years of IT experience as a Sysadmin , DevOps Architect, and
Amazon EC2 Proyect manager.
AWS Lambda
Amazon Web Services (AWS) Working in an international project: American, Indian and spanish
Engineers team. NDC analytics: help Airlines identify and incentivize
Languages agencies that are top performers to optimize sales strategy.
Inglés
Design and Build customer infrastructures with IaC: Terraform and
Cloudformation.
Technologies: jenkins, ansible, dockers, cloud, openshift, containers,
pods, git, gitlab.
Strong DevOps technical skills: Automation: Ansible, Jenkins stack,
jenkins pipelines, groovy, git, Openshift Red Hat cloud
kubernetes cluster installation
Traditional Systems skills: Unix (Linux and Solaris) and Application
Servers (Weblogic, Jboss) administration and Architecture
configuration.
Red Hat Linux Administration via ansible roles.
Red Hat Certificated:
Red Hat Sales Engineer Specialist - Platform-as-a-Service (PaaS)
Red Hat Sales Specialist - Infrastructure-as-a-Service (IaaS)
Red Hat Sales Specialist - Platform-as-a-Service (PaaS)
Experiencia
Accelya Group
Page 1 of 6
Cloud DevOps and SRE Engineer
junio de 2022 - Present (2 años 8 meses)
Madrid, Community of Madrid, Spain
Working in an international project: American, Indian and spanish Engineers
team.
NDC analytics: help Airlines identify and incentivize agencies that are top
performers to optimize sales strategy.
Improve multiple facets of the software development life cycle (SDLC) process
using a mix of practices, tools, and technologies.
AWS Cloud Infra design with modern DevOps solutions, IaC concept
(Terraform, Cloud Formation).
Gitlab premium CI/CD pipelines: test, sonarqube, build and deploy : java and
python projects.
Vulnerability Management: Amazon Inspector scanning and vulnerability
remediation of EC2 instances and lambda functions.
Mindcurv
Lead Devops engineer at Mindcurv.com
diciembre de 2016 - enero de 2022 (5 años 2 meses)
Madrid Area, Spain
Working closely with a team of Engineers in India to design a Cloud
infrastructure e-commerce. Half of the time by managing the engineer team,
and half of the time by executing myself the technical tasks:
- DevOps, Automation, Engineering and continuous integration.
- Design and implementation of fully automated Continuous Integration,
Continuous Delivery, Continuous Deployment pipelines and DevOps
processes for Agile projects build on e-commerce platform (Oracle ATG).
- DevOps technologies: Jenkins, ansible roles, git
- Open Source ELK stack: App (Legacy) Logs: logstash - Kafka queues -
logstash (with grok) - ElasticSearch
Page 2 of 6
- Open source Logs management with fluentd (Microservices) -- kafka --
logstash (without grok) -- Elastic search
- Logging log files Architecture:
- Histrix commands and metrics:
aplication ---> Telegraf ---> Influxdb (Direct connection) --> Grafana
- Application log files:
application --> json format --> fluentd ---> [ kafka ---> logstash (some files gelf
format, some not) --> threads (1 for each consumer) ---> Elastic search ] -->
Kibana
- Installation and configuration of local FluentD client in every Jboss server and
configured to send logs to ES via Kafka
- Micro services cluster architecture (Openshift): one fluentd container running
per node. All the pods running on the node will register with the fluentd
container running on that node and will send the logs through it.
- Metrics Openshift pods: Microservice container -- Telegraf -- influxdb --
Grafana
- Operation System metrics on every virtual machine -- nagios --snmp -- omd --
Nagflux -- influxdb -- Grafana
- Microservices with docker / pods architecture with Red Hat Openshift
Platform
- Open source management stack: Jira, Confluence, Slack, Mavenlink,
Calamari
- Linux Red Hat administration viva ansible roles.
- Strong bash Shell administration shell scripts.
- Red Hat Sales Specialist - Infrastructure-as-a-Service (IaaS). accreditation
diploma
ICEX
Page 3 of 6
System Architect
enero de 2010 - diciembre de 2016 (7 años)
Madrid Area, Spain
Identification Management Administrator: Oracle OAM OID identity
configuration of users in the central system of ICEX: configuration of Front End
OHS, rules, protected resources, autentication and autorization.
Oracle Universal Content Management (UCM) (formerly Stellent):
Administration and install of new patches and install new applications .ear in
the SSXA instances.
Application Server Architect: J2EE-compliant application servers in multi-tier
architectures: Weblogic (10.3, 8.1), Apache-Tomcat, JBoss, BBDD Oracle
(10g), SQL Server (2005, 2008):
Oracle Weblogic 10.3: Weblogic installation, Domains creation, Server
creation and configuration: Setting Java Heap size in each server of the
domain, Datasouce configuration: connection to Oracle, and SQL Server
database , security ssl certificate installation, EAR deployments, WLST: writing
scripts to deploy the application in WebLogic Server, logs troubleshooting.
Linux Red Hat and Centos installation and configuration into a Vmware ESX
hypervisor: filesystems , users, applications, selinux, firewall, lvm
Configuration of Front-End services with Apache server: Weblogic Plug-in,
virtual hosts.
Switch configuration: Installation, maintenance and configuration of HP
Procurve Switch: configuration of vlans, routing, log facilities, security: ssh, of
ICEX commercial Offices.
Telefónica I+D
Systems Administrator
agosto de 2000 - enero de 2010 (9 años 6 meses)
Pozuelo De Alarcón Area, Spain
-Unix (Sun Solaris 2.6, 2.7, 2.8, 2.10) (Installation, Administration,
Patches, Tunning): SO installation, recommended patches installation,
network configuration: interfaces ethernet IP Address settings and
route setting, administration: users, passwords, groups, automatic boot
application configuration, sunfreeware applications installation (lsof, rsync,
etc…),company applications installation, tuning: cpu, memory, networking ,
Page 4 of 6
trouble shooting and identify bottle necks with tools like Solaris snoop, netstat,
etc...
- Application Servers: Weblogic Server, Iplanet, IIS, ATG-Dynamo (Installation,
Administration, web services architecture, drp´s monitoring) Apache:
Installation, compilation (static and dynamic libraries, servlets), Weblogic
Server (4.5, 5.1, 6.1, ..)
Cap Gemini Sogeti
Console Operator
junio de 2000 - julio de 2000 (2 meses)
Madrid Area, Spain
- AS-400 IBM servers Administration: Planed and organized the running
of system jobs and processes, informed management, systems, and
programming personnel of errors and problems with job processes and
equipment, Backup monitoring, monitoring the correct execution of automatic
jobs, CL Code Incident solving when one job fails, Handled job queues and
console messages and ensured deadlines and production standards are met.
Quiero TV Digital
Console Operator
enero de 1999 - mayo de 1999 (5 meses)
Madrid Area, Spain
- Basic administration tasks with Windows NT Server Domain Controller:
Users management, add, create and modifies users in the Windows NT Net
of the Company, quotas and permissions management, ensure the correct
configuration of these accounts.
- Processes and Back-up control, Management, operating and launching of
automatic processes and Back-up: magnetical tape preparation and load.
- Management of Intranet Web Administration: monitoring the Web and restart
if it was down.
- Ars Remedy and Biz Manager: application management: add and create user
profiles in Biz Manager, and monitoring Remedy system in order to keep the
system up and running.
- Help-Desk tasks: Telephone support of the call-center users.
Page 5 of 6
Educación
Universidad Nacional de Educación a Distancia - U.N.E.D.
Ciencias Matemáticas, Estadística · (2016 - 2017)
Page 6 of 6